Excellence in Mobility Management

The nominees for this award are Mobility Managers who:


  • Problem solve
  • Tirelessly advocate for those who need transportation
  • Facilitate group discussions and problem-solving groups
  • Teach on content and process
  • Communicate to connect people, agencies, and systems
  • Cheer lead to champion the enterprising spirit of potential solution makers
  • Collaborate with communities and organizations
  • Convene meetings and teams of professionals to solve transportation needs
  • Envision a better transportation system in their region and the larger Northwest region

ADA Professional of the Year

The nominees for this award are Transportation Professionals who:

  • Do not discriminate against people with disabilities in the provision of their services
  • Comply with requirements for accessibility
  • Provide courteous and efficient service
  • Stay up to date on training and best practices as they relate to providing transportation to people with a variety of special needs.

Driver of the Year

The nominees for this award are Transportation Professionals who:

  • Have 24 months or more with no Preventable Accidents
  • Demonstrate Flexibility
  • Demonstrate Safe driving
  • Are reliable
  • Provide good customer service
